Dean Cain recently spoke with SciFi
Wire about his upcoming role in the TV movie URBAN DECAY, and even though I have
an immense love of zombies, my dislike of Dean Cain will still prevent me from
seeing this flick.

However, for those who don’t have a Cain allergy, here’s how Cain explained the
film to SciFi: “There’s an urban legend about a guy they
call Puss Head [Brad Orrison],” Cain said in an interview. “This guy exists
inside the black community. Growing up, people would always say, ‘If you don’t
get home before dark, Puss Head is going to get you!’ And Puss Head is this
character who apparently is half dead, half alive, very zombie-like, very much
within the genre. He kills my fiancee, who’s played by Brooke Burns, and she’s
damn good-looking, so I’m pissed. So I go after the guy and start hunting him
down, and my character becomes a vigilante zombie chaser.”
